HB5284

Occupations: individual licensing and registration; procedure for vacating disciplinary records of certain licensees or registrants; provide for. Amends secs. 729, 2009 & 2627 of 1980 PA 299 (MCL 339.729 et seq.) & adds sec. 2504b.

Chamber Passed·12/17/25

Michigan HB5284 amends continuing education requirements for real estate appraisers and certified public accountants.

Michigan HB5284 modifies the continuing education requirements for real estate appraisers and certified public accountants. For real estate appraisers, it mandates at least 40 hours of continuing education per license cycle, with specific hours allocated for auditing, accounting, and professional ethics. It allows for the carryover of excess hours to the next year, with limits on the amount that can be carried over. The bill also provides a procedure for setting aside disciplinary records for a failure to complete continuing education, subject to certain conditions.
